[Goodies-commits] r2534 - xfce4-netload-plugin/trunk xfce4-radio-plugin/trunk

Jean-François Wauthy pollux at xfce.org
Fri Mar 2 22:16:33 CET 2007


Author: pollux
Date: 2007-03-02 21:16:33 +0000 (Fri, 02 Mar 2007)
New Revision: 2534

Added:
   xfce4-netload-plugin/trunk/configure.in.in
   xfce4-radio-plugin/trunk/configure.in.in
Removed:
   xfce4-netload-plugin/trunk/configure.ac
   xfce4-radio-plugin/trunk/configure.ac
Modified:
   xfce4-netload-plugin/trunk/autogen.sh
   xfce4-radio-plugin/trunk/autogen.sh
Log:
add support for LINGUAS

Modified: xfce4-netload-plugin/trunk/autogen.sh
===================================================================
--- xfce4-netload-plugin/trunk/autogen.sh	2007-03-02 17:53:48 UTC (rev 2533)
+++ xfce4-netload-plugin/trunk/autogen.sh	2007-03-02 21:16:33 UTC (rev 2534)
@@ -18,6 +18,11 @@
   exit 1
 }
 
+linguas=`sed -e '/^#/d' po/LINGUAS`
+revision=`LC_ALL=C svn info $0 | awk '/^Revision: / {printf "%05d\n", $2}'`
+sed -e "s/@LINGUAS@/${linguas}/g" \
+    -e "s/@REVISION@/${revision}/g" \
+        < "configure.in.in" > "configure.in"
 
 exec xdt-autogen $@
 

Deleted: xfce4-netload-plugin/trunk/configure.ac

Copied: xfce4-netload-plugin/trunk/configure.in.in (from rev 2533, xfce4-netload-plugin/trunk/configure.ac)
===================================================================
--- xfce4-netload-plugin/trunk/configure.in.in	                        (rev 0)
+++ xfce4-netload-plugin/trunk/configure.in.in	2007-03-02 21:16:33 UTC (rev 2534)
@@ -0,0 +1,68 @@
+dnl configure.ac
+dnl
+dnl xfce4-netload-plugin - Netload plugin for xfce4-panel
+dnl
+dnl 2003 Benedikt Meurer <benedikt.meurer at unix-ag.uni-siegen.de>
+dnl
+
+m4_define([netload_version],[0.4.0])
+
+AC_INIT([xfce4-netload-plugin], [netload_version()],
+	[xfce-goodies-dev at lists.berlios.de])
+
+NETLOAD_VERSION=netload_version()
+AM_INIT_AUTOMAKE([xfce4-netload-plugin], [$NETLOAD_VERSION])
+AM_CONFIG_HEADER([config.h])
+
+AM_MAINTAINER_MODE
+
+dnl Check for basic programs
+AC_PROG_CC
+AC_PROG_INSTALL
+AC_PROG_INTLTOOL
+
+dnl Check for standard header files
+AC_HEADER_STDC
+
+dnl Substitute in Makefiles
+AC_SUBST(OS)
+
+AC_CHECK_FUNCS([gethostname])
+AC_CHECK_FUNCS([memset])
+AC_CHECK_FUNCS([socket])
+AC_CHECK_FUNCS([strstr])
+AC_CHECK_FUNCS([malloc])
+AC_CHECK_FUNCS([bzero])
+AC_CHECK_HEADERS([arpa/inet.h])
+AC_CHECK_HEADERS([netinet/in.h])
+AC_CHECK_HEADERS([stdlib.h])
+AC_CHECK_HEADERS([string.h])
+AC_CHECK_HEADERS([sys/ioctl.h])
+AC_CHECK_HEADERS([sys/param.h])
+AC_CHECK_HEADERS([sys/socket.h])
+AC_CHECK_HEADERS([sys/time.h])
+AC_CHECK_HEADERS([unistd.h])
+AC_CHECK_HEADERS([sys/sockio.h])
+AC_HEADER_SYS_WAIT
+AC_PROG_GCC_TRADITIONAL
+AC_TYPE_SIZE_T
+
+AC_CHECK_LIB(kstat, kstat_open, SOLLIBS="-lkstat -lsocket", SOLLIBS="")
+AC_CHECK_LIB(nsl, kstat_open, SOLLIBS="$SOLLIBS -linet_ntop", SOLLIBS="$SOLLIBS")
+AC_SUBST(SOLLIBS)
+
+dnl configure the panel plugin
+XDT_CHECK_PACKAGE([LIBXFCE4PANEL], [libxfce4panel-1.0], [4.3.20])
+
+dnl Check for i18n support
+XDT_I18N([@LINGUAS@])
+
+dnl Check for debugging support
+XDT_FEATURE_DEBUG()
+
+AC_OUTPUT([
+Makefile
+panel-plugin/Makefile
+po/Makefile.in
+])
+

Modified: xfce4-radio-plugin/trunk/autogen.sh
===================================================================
--- xfce4-radio-plugin/trunk/autogen.sh	2007-03-02 17:53:48 UTC (rev 2533)
+++ xfce4-radio-plugin/trunk/autogen.sh	2007-03-02 21:16:33 UTC (rev 2534)
@@ -18,4 +18,10 @@
   exit 1
 }
 
+linguas=`sed -e '/^#/d' po/LINGUAS`
+revision=`LC_ALL=C svn info $0 | awk '/^Revision: / {printf "%05d\n", $2}'`
+sed -e "s/@LINGUAS@/${linguas}/g" \
+    -e "s/@REVISION@/${revision}/g" \
+        < "configure.in.in" > "configure.in"
+
 exec xdt-autogen $@

Deleted: xfce4-radio-plugin/trunk/configure.ac

Copied: xfce4-radio-plugin/trunk/configure.in.in (from rev 2533, xfce4-radio-plugin/trunk/configure.ac)
===================================================================
--- xfce4-radio-plugin/trunk/configure.in.in	                        (rev 0)
+++ xfce4-radio-plugin/trunk/configure.in.in	2007-03-02 21:16:33 UTC (rev 2534)
@@ -0,0 +1,46 @@
+dnl configure.ac
+dnl
+dnl xfce4-radio-plugin - <Plugin for xfce4-panel>
+dnl
+dnl 2006 Stefan Ott <stefan at desire.ch>
+dnl
+
+m4_define([radio_plugin_version],[0.2.0])
+
+AC_INIT([xfce4-radio-plugin], [radio_plugin_version()],
+	[xfce-goodies-dev at lists.berlios.de])
+
+RADIO_PLUGIN_VERSION=radio_plugin_version()
+AM_INIT_AUTOMAKE([xfce4-radio-plugin], [$RADIO_PLUGIN_VERSION])
+AM_CONFIG_HEADER([config.h])
+
+AM_MAINTAINER_MODE
+
+dnl Check for UNIX variants
+AC_AIX
+AC_ISC_POSIX
+AC_MINIX
+
+dnl Check for basic programs
+AC_PROG_CC
+AC_PROG_INSTALL
+AC_PROG_INTLTOOL
+
+dnl Check for standard header files
+AC_HEADER_STDC
+
+dnl configure the panel plugin
+XDT_CHECK_PACKAGE([LIBXFCE4PANEL], [libxfce4panel-1.0], [4.3.22])
+
+dnl check for i18n support
+XDT_I18N([@LINGUAS@])
+
+dnl Check for debugging support
+XDT_FEATURE_DEBUG()
+
+AC_OUTPUT([
+Makefile
+panel-plugin/Makefile
+icons/Makefile
+po/Makefile.in
+])




More information about the Goodies-commits mailing list